2013 Maryland Code
FINANCIAL INSTITUTIONS
§ 9-301 - Member
§9-301.
(a) A member of a savings and loan association means a holder, as shown on the association’s records, of:
(1) One or more savings accounts, as to a mutual association; and
(2) One or more shares of capital stock, as to a capital stock association.
(b) (1) Multiple holders of a single account or share of capital stock shall be considered a single member.
(2) Notice to one holder of a multiple name account or share of capital stock is sufficient notice to all holders.
